/**
* Usage scenario:
* HA: CreatePeer(id) -> JVM: is extension inited?
* if not yet - look in registry of registred extensions, or just
* ask all registred ext DLL - can they handle this type - use latest
* version of handler, call JVMPExt_Init() of matching DLL,
* load and run bootstrap class
* if yes - just instanciate proper peer, using special factory
* registred by bootstrap class in PluggableJVM.
*/
struct JVMP_Extension {
/**
* Init native part of this extension.
* Argument is side on which extension is loaded, if in
* separate process situation (0 - not separate process case
* 1 - host side, 2 - JVM side).
*/
jint (JNICALL *JVMPExt_Init)(jint side);
/**
* Shutdown this extension. Usually means nobody wants it anymore.
*/
jint (JNICALL *JVMPExt_Shutdown)();
/**
* the only function which can be called before Init
* pCID - contract ID, pVersion - version of handler
*/
jint (JNICALL *JVMPExt_GetExtInfo)(const char* *pCID,
jint *pVersion,
JVMP_ExtDescription* *desc);
/**
* Return classpath to find bootstrap Java class, and its name
* Classpath is "|"-separated list of URLs, like
* jar:file:///usr/java/ext/mozilla/moz6_ext.jar|file:///usr/java/ext/mozilla/classes|http://www.mozilla.org/Waterfall/classes
* Name is smth like: sun.jvmp.mozilla.MozillaPeerFactory
*/
jint (JNICALL *JVMPExt_GetBootstrapClass)(char* *bootstrapClassPath,
char* *bootstrapClassName);
/**
* This is extension's callback to schedule request in host
* in different proc or STA situation.
* Different methods executed depending
* on funcno in request, use macros to numerate your functions:
* JVMP_NEW_EXT_FUNCNO(vendorID, funcno). Implementation of this callback
* is application/platform dependent. It can be implemented using
* XtAddEventHandler on X, SendMessage on Win32.
* If local == JNI_TRUE - just execute this request locally.
*/
jint (JNICALL *JVMPExt_ScheduleRequest)(JVMP_ShmRequest* req, jint local);
/**
* This function reserves capabilities space for this extension.
* Arguments are two caps bitfields - first one is set of capabilities this
* extension is interesting, and secind describes sharing policy on this set
* of caps:
* if bit set - this cap is to be shared.
* After this call for all decisions on caps in this range
* delegated to AccessControlDecider of this extension.
* If access to capability range is shared, then Waterfall chains
* all deciders for given capability, if anyone forbids capability setting
* - this capability not granted.
*/
jint (JNICALL *JVMPExt_GetCapsRange)(JVMP_SecurityCap* caps,
JVMP_SecurityCap* sh_mask);
};
